State Level Environmental Impact Assessment Authority (SEIAA)
- SEIAA is constituted by the Central Government under section 3 of the Environment (Protection) Act, 1986
- Consists of 3 members: a Chairman and two other members
- Chairman must be experienced in environmental policy or management and fulfil the criteria in Appendix VI
- Other member must be an expert fulfilling the eligibility criteria in Appendix VI
- The Member-Secretary is a serving officer of the relevant state government or Union Territory
- State government/UT to forward names of members and chairman to Central government within 30 days of receiving names
- Members and chairman have a 3 year term, but Central government may extend up to 12 months
- All decisions are typically unanimous, but if a decision is by majority then details for and against are recorded in minutes and sent to MoEF
District Level Environmental Impact Assessment Authority (DEIAA)
- DEIAA is constituted by the Central Government under section 3 of the Environment (Protection) Act, 1986
- Consists of 4 members: a Chairperson, Member-Secretary, and two other members
- Chairperson is the District Magistrate or District Collector
- Member-Secretary is the Sub-divisional Magistrate or Sub-divisional Officer of the concerned district
- Two other members include the seniormost Divisional Forest Officer and an expert nominated by the Divisional Commissioner or Chief Conservator of Forests (qualifications in Appendix VII)
